Output 993cf76d4f716ce14801737cfaa41ba7d2593becfc461b3dd05152d7bb6fae66:1

value
3741895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bce3336d61284c96940c3cbb213a30a1765c6780 OP_EQUAL
address
3Jum8oVCp3KQHdwhmU32v6Vnz61AzUWuVf
transaction
993cf76d4f716ce14801737cfaa41ba7d2593becfc461b3dd05152d7bb6fae66
confirmations
104228
spent
true